Detailed vulnerability description

The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to perform denial of service (DoS) attack.

The vulnerability exists due to integer underflow when processing FAAD2 media files. A remote attacker can create a specially crafted media file, trick the victim to open it, trigger integer underflow and crash the affected application.


How to mitigate CVE-2019-5459

Install updates from vendor's website.
